Multiple calls On Hold
When you have more than one call on hold, use the navigation key to
highlight a call on the LCD screen. You can perform an action with that
call by using the context-sensitive soft keys on the In-call menu list. The
context-sensitive soft keys displayed vary depending on the type of call
that is currently selected. For example, a held call has the Activate
context-sensitive soft key instead of the Audio context-sensitive soft key.
When you highlight a call that is not active, you can retrieve the call from
on hold and make it active by pressing the Activate context-sensitive soft
key. You can also join the call with the active call to create a 3-way calling
session. See “Using 3-way calling” on page 163.

1. To retrieve a call on hold do one of the
following:
Press the Line feature key beside
the flashing LCD indicator.
— Press the Hold fixed key.
